Given the vectors, a=3i+4j, b=-2i+5j, c=10i-j, d=-1/3i+5/2j, find -0.4a-0.3b+0.2d=?

Answer:
[tex]-\frac{2}{3}i - \frac{13}{5}j[/tex]
Step-by-step explanation:
-0.4(3i + 4i) - 0.3(-2i + 5j) + 0.2(-[tex]\frac{1}{3}i[/tex] + [tex]\frac{5}{2}[/tex]j)
-1.2i - 1.6j + 0.6i - 1.5j - [tex]\frac{0.2}{3}[/tex]i + 0.5j
Converting to fraction form;
[tex]-\frac{6}{5}i + \frac{3}{5}i - \frac{1}{15}i - \frac{8}{5}j - \frac{3}{2}j + \frac{1}{2} j[/tex]
Solving the i part;
[tex]\frac{-18i + 9i - i}{15}[/tex] = [tex]-\frac{2}{3}i[/tex]
Solving the j part;
[tex]\frac{-16j-15j+5j}{10} = -\frac{13}{5}[/tex]j
So -0.4a - o.3b + 0.2d = [tex]-\frac{2}{3}i[/tex] - [tex]\frac{13}{5}j[/tex]
